原发性多形性胶质母细胞瘤7号染色体等位基因失平衡状况的研究
Study on allelic imbalance of chromosome 7 in primary glioblastoma multiforme
【摘要】 目的研究原发性多形性胶质母细胞瘤7号染色体等位基因失平衡(allelicimbalance,AI)发生率,寻找与胶质母细胞瘤发生、发展可能相关的染色体区域。方法应用聚合酶链反应(PCR)方法,通过荧光标记引物和377型DNA序列自动分析仪,对20例原发性胶质母细胞瘤患者7号染色体上的22个微卫星多态性标记进行杂合性丢失(lossofheterozygosity,LOH)分析。结果20例患者中50%(10例)存在7号染色体等位基因失平衡,在可提供信息的位点中37.8%(126/333)存在等位基因失平衡。其中7q和7p的等位基因失平衡率分别为50%(10/20)和45%(9/20)。在7q31.3~32上的D7S640~D7S684区域和7q36上的D7S2465位点等位基因失平衡检出率高达50%~58.3%。结论7号染色体的分子遗传学异常可能在原发性胶质母细胞瘤的分子发病机制中发挥重要作用,在7q31.3~32上的D7S640~D7S684区域和7q36上的D7S2465位点所在区域可能存在与原发性胶质母细胞瘤相关的肿瘤基因。
【Abstract】 Objective Allelic imbalance (AI) on chromosome 7 in primary glioblastoma multiforme (GBM) was detected to locate the chromosomal regions probably associated with the pathogenesis of GBM. Methods All of the 22 microsatellite polymorphism markers on chromosome 7 in 20 cases with GBM were detected by polymerase chain reaction (PCR) technique with fluorescence-labeled primers and Perkin Elmer 377 DNA sequencer and the loss of heterozygosity (LOH) in them was analyzed. Results Of the 20 cases with GBM, 50% (10/20) with AI on chromosome 7, allelic imbalance was occurred in 37.8% (126/333) of informative loci. The allelic imbalance rate on 7q and 7p were 50% (10/20) and 45% (9/20) respectively and most frequently occurred at locus D7S2465 on 7q36 and between loci D7S640 and D7S684 on 7q31.3-32 with imbalance rate 50%-58.3%. Conclusion Molecular genetic abnormality of chromosome 7 may play an important role on the molecular pathogenesis in GBM. The chromosomal regions at locus D7S2465 on 7q36 and between loci D7S640 and D7S684 on 7q 31.3-32 may exist oncogenes associated with GBM.
